Mineral Rights Defined
Mineral rights embody the possession of precious assets situated beneath the floor of a property. These assets can embrace oil, fuel, coal, treasured metals, and numerous different minerals. The possession of those rights will be complicated, usually intertwined with floor rights, making a multifaceted authorized construction. It is necessary to acknowledge the authorized implications of mineral rights and the way they influence land use and useful resource extraction.
Floor Rights vs. Mineral Rights
Function | Floor Rights | Mineral Rights |
---|---|---|
Description | Possession of the land’s seen options, together with the soil, vegetation, and enhancements like buildings. | Possession of the dear assets discovered beneath the floor, akin to oil, fuel, coal, and different minerals. |
Possession | Usually held by the landowner until explicitly separated. | May be held individually from floor rights, usually by totally different events. |
Use | Contains use for agriculture, building, and residential functions. | Contains rights to extract and make the most of minerals, doubtlessly impacting floor use. |
Transferability | Typically transferred with the property until in any other case specified within the deed. | May be transferred independently of floor rights, permitting for separate sale or lease. |
Understanding the distinct options of floor rights and mineral rights is essential for anybody concerned in actual property transactions. This desk offers a transparent overview of their key traits, highlighting their unbiased nature and potential for separate possession and use. This readability is important for knowledgeable choices in property dealings.

Kinds of Mineral Leases

Unlocking the riches hidden beneath the floor usually entails navigating numerous lease constructions. Every kind presents a novel set of advantages and disadvantages, making the selection essential for maximizing returns and minimizing dangers. Understanding these variations is essential to creating knowledgeable choices within the thrilling world of mineral exploration and extraction.
Manufacturing Cost
Manufacturing funds signify a compelling different to conventional lease preparations. They operate as a share of the mineral manufacturing, with funds tied on to the extracted assets. This construction usually proves helpful for lessors searching for a simple return tied to output. A key benefit is the lessor’s potential to obtain earnings with out managing the complete course of.
- Benefits: The lessor receives earnings instantly linked to the manufacturing output, doubtlessly decreasing the monetary burden of administration and threat. This strategy additionally presents flexibility within the phrases of cost, usually based mostly on the amount of extracted minerals. Manufacturing funds will be structured to incentivize elevated manufacturing by the lessee, offering a mutually helpful association.
- Disadvantages: The lessor’s earnings depends on the success of the lessee’s operations. Fluctuations in mineral costs and manufacturing volumes can instantly influence the lessor’s returns. Moreover, administration and oversight of the cost construction can current complexities, requiring meticulous monitoring and accounting procedures.
Internet Income Curiosity
A web income curiosity (NPI) grants the lessor a share of the income generated from mineral extraction after deducting all working prices and bills. This construction is especially enticing for lessors searching for a share of the upside with out the obligations of direct operational involvement.
- Benefits: The lessor’s return is tied to the profitability of the enterprise, mitigating the danger related to fluctuating mineral costs. This construction additionally offers a chance for lessors to take part within the success of the enterprise with out direct involvement in day-to-day operations.
- Disadvantages: The lessor’s earnings is contingent on the profitability of the challenge. Intervals of low profitability may end up in minimal or no returns for the lessor. Negotiating the exact calculation of prices and bills will be complicated and require cautious authorized evaluation.
Royalty Lease
A royalty lease is a standard and well-understood association, the place the lessor receives a hard and fast share of the income generated from the extracted minerals. This simple construction simplifies the earnings stream for the lessor.
- Benefits: A royalty lease offers a predictable and secure earnings stream, linked to a share of the income. This construction is mostly simple to grasp and administer, making it a most well-liked possibility for a lot of lessors.
- Disadvantages: The lessor’s earnings is instantly tied to the sale value of the extracted minerals. Fluctuations in market costs can considerably have an effect on the lessor’s returns. Royalty leases usually lack the potential for revenue sharing based mostly on the lessee’s success, doubtlessly lacking out on increased returns in periods of great profitability.
Comparability Desk
Lease Kind | Description | Benefits | Disadvantages |
---|---|---|---|
Manufacturing Cost | Share of mineral manufacturing | Revenue tied to output, versatile cost phrases | Depending on lessee’s success, potential complexity |
Internet Income Curiosity | Share of income after prices | Participation in enterprise success, diminished operational involvement | Depending on challenge profitability, complicated value calculation |
Royalty Lease | Fastened share of income | Predictable earnings, simple administration | Tied to mineral costs, potential for missed income |

Key Phrases and Circumstances
Understanding the important thing phrases and situations is important to understand the settlement’s implications. These phrases set up the parameters of the lease, together with the period, the precise minerals lined, the cost construction, and the obligations of every occasion.
- Lease Time period: The settlement specifies the period of the lease, sometimes in years, outlining the interval for exploration and extraction actions. A shorter time period would possibly go well with a smaller exploration challenge, whereas a long term might accommodate a extra complete extraction course of.
- Description of Minerals: The settlement clearly defines the minerals topic to the lease, together with particular sorts and grades, to keep away from ambiguity and disputes. This part additionally would possibly delineate areas on the property which can be particularly excluded from the lease.
- Royalty Clause: This essential element Artikels the proportion of the extracted minerals the landowner receives as cost. It ensures the landowner receives a fair proportion of the income generated from the minerals.
- Cost Schedule: The settlement ought to stipulate how and when the lessee will compensate the landowner. This may increasingly contain upfront funds, ongoing royalties, or a mixture of each.
- Exploration and Growth: This clause Artikels the lessee’s obligations concerning exploration and growth actions, together with required testing and timelines.
- Nicely Upkeep: This clause is especially necessary in oil and fuel leases and specifies the lessee’s obligations in sustaining and repairing wells.
- Default Provisions: These situations tackle what occurs if the lessee fails to adjust to the phrases of the settlement. This would possibly embrace penalties or termination choices for the landowner.
Royalty Clause Instance
“The Lessor shall obtain a royalty of 12.5% of the gross worth of all minerals extracted from the leased premises. Funds might be made quarterly inside 60 days of the top of every quarter.”
This instance royalty clause clearly defines the royalty charge and cost frequency, safeguarding the landowner’s share.
State and Jurisdictional Variations
Mineral lease agreements can differ considerably by state and jurisdiction. Particular laws, environmental legal guidelines, and customary practices inside a selected area usually form the phrases and situations.
- State Laws: Every state has distinctive laws concerning mineral rights and leases, impacting points akin to royalty charges, environmental safeguards, and allowing processes. Landowners should rigorously contemplate these laws to make sure their settlement aligns with relevant legal guidelines.
- Native Ordinances: Native ordinances might additional influence the lease settlement, akin to restrictions on land use or particular environmental laws.
